Alton Democrat October 3, 1946

Mrs, E. Auchstetter Mrs. Elizabeth Auchstetter passed away ai 7 o'clock Tuesday morning at Doornink's hospital at Orange City, following a ten day illness, at the age of 79 years, 9 months and 13 days.

Elizabeth Keup was born near Princeton, IL. Dec. 11, 1866. When yet a child she moved with her parents to Tama, Iowa where she grew to woman hood. Sept. 4, 1889 s h e was married to John Auchstetter and they begun housekeeping on the farm south east of Hospers, where she made her home ever since, residing with her son Lawrence and family since the death of her husband on Dec 15, 1927. Mrs. Auchstetter was the mother of eight children, as follows: Mary, Mrs. Edward Croatt, Elmer and George, all of Madison, MN; Louis who died in infancy; Anthony of Granville, Lawrence and Charles of Hospers and Rose, Mrs. Ray Ahlers who passed away on Jan. 4, 19-
40.

She is also survived by 25 grandchildren, and eight great grandchildren, two brothers, George and William Keup and two sisters, Mrs. Eva Kendrick and Mrs. Anna Campbell, all of Tama, Iowa. Deceased was a member of St. Anthony's Catholic church where services were held Friday morning at 9:30, Rev. John Thoennisen celebrating the Reguiem High Mass. Interment was in St. Anthony’s cemetery.
